    Descrição

    Purpose:

    This position supports the Regional Disaster Cycle Services (DCS) department. Disaster Action Team (DAT) ServiceAssociates serve on a team to provide 24-hour immediate support and assistance to individuals and families whohave been impacted by a home fire or other local disaster

    Responsibilities:

    • Works as part of an assigned team to respond to local disasters within established time frames
    • defined in the Disaster Action Team Program Standards & Procedures.
    • Commits to being available during assigned shifts in RC Respond, the DAT scheduling system, andcommunicating scheduling conflicts with DAT Leadership.
    • Maintains regular communication with Duty Officer and other members of the team while assigned toan event to ensure continuity and safety.
    • Creates cases in RC Care, and complete confirmations as a second responder.
    • Provides care, comfort, and compassion to clients (in accordance with Red Cross standards andprocedures).
    • Works with on-scene DAT leader to assess whether additional resources/support are required andcommunicates those needs to DAT Leadership.
    • Tracks, issues, and maintains personal inventory of Client Assistance Cards.
    • Attends regularly scheduled team/DAT meetings as required by Chapter/Region.
    • Supports DAT capacity building by mentoring and training DAT responders on DAT responses andexercises when available.
    • Maintains RC Care Intake Worker user access
